In today’s episode, we are talking alcohol…a touchy subject for some, but we wanted to shed some light on an area that can really impact our health significantly during the holiday season. As with anything, balance is key and we’re sharing ways to keep your cocktails healthy and bright while being mindful of your limits, bully bartenders and sneaky alcohol marketing.

We’ve got a few favorites in the spirit and wine department that we wanted to share with you that may make cocktail decision making a whole lot easier. And for all the non-drinkers in the room – we didn’t forget about you! Having tasty non-alcoholic drink options is a must and we’ve got some great ideas for festive holiday drinks!
